Fallout is an oldschool kind of game and you have to keep that in mind when you play it. It lacks a lot of modern game mechanics, there are no glowing objects or floating arrows to let you know what you can interact with, no handy tutorial levels, no handholding at all. You are on your own in a post-apocalyptic wasteland and if you misstep you will be chunks of meat scattered across the road.
Once you 'get it', though. It's one of the greatest games you will ever play.
